When was the last time you looked in the mirror and felt critical of what you saw? Most of us have had moments — or seasons — of unhappiness with our bodies. In this first part of the Body Image Mindset mini-series, we're talking about why that happens, why it’s completely normal, and why you’re not broken for feeling this way.This episode explores:How early comments or criticism about our bodies can shape lifelong beliefs (Listen to episode 57)The impact of growing up surrounded by magazines and media showing “ideal” (and often unreal) womenWhy our brains are wired to compare ourselves to others — and how that ties back to a basic human need for safety and belongingWhat happens to our body image when change (like menopause) meets our brain’s resistance to changeThe role of the subconscious mind — especially the reticular activating system — in reinforcing negative body thoughtsCheryl reminds us that much of our body criticism comes from subconscious survival mechanisms. Your brain is trying to keep you safe and help you “fit in,” but it can sometimes turn against you with harsh self-talk. Recognizing that process is the first step toward shifting it.You’ll also hear how to start releasing self-judgment — through awareness, forgiveness, and practices like tapping — so that you can move toward a kinder, more compassionate relationship with your body.💛 This is Part 1 of a four-part Mindset Deep Dive series available exclusively for subscribers.
